Great to meet you!

I’m a licensed clinical social worker with over a decade of experience supporting individuals through life’s most complex emotional, relational, and health-related challenges. With a Master’s in Social Work and a Master’s in Education in Human Sexuality from Widener University, I bring a deeply informed, trauma-sensitive, and sex-positive approach to therapy.

My approach to therapy

Throughout my career, I’ve had the privilege of working with diverse communities—from supporting Veterans in the VA’s Home-Based Primary Care Program in Los Angeles, to providing compassionate end-of-life care with VITAS Healthcare, and empowering caregivers and older adults in Washington, D.C. My clinical style is integrative and collaborative, drawing on evidence-based modalities including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Emotionally Focused Therapy (EFT), Narrative Therapy, Psychodynamic Theory, and Solution-Focused Therapy.

What you can expect from me

Whether I’m working with someone navigating grief, relationship transitions, identity exploration, or caregiving stress, my goal is to create a safe, affirming space where healing and growth are possible. I also bring a strong foundation in LGBTQ+ affirmative care, informed by my academic training and personal commitment to equity and inclusion.
